NOREG will not take part in the upcoming WESG World Finals due to visa issues, Morten "zEVES" Vollan has revealed.
In a Twitter post, the 26-year-old explained that the team "did not have enough time" to obtain visas to participate in the event, which is set to start on Tuesday.
NOREG, who had qualified for the WESG Finals after finishing top 12 at the European regional event, become the third team to pull out of the $1.5 million competition, following the withdrawals of Ukraine and EMC.
The Norwegian side and EMC had been drawn in the very same group, which is now down to just two teams, MAX and ORDER.
Meanwhile, Morten "zEVES" Vollan Christensen revealed that NOREG will attend the BYOC qualifier for the upcoming Copenhagen Games event, which will take place from March 28 to April 1.
Noreg will not participate in WESG World Finals in China this coming week due to VISA problems. This would have been a great event for us but unfortunately we did not have enough time. On the other hand, we will travel to @copenhagengames instead. I hope you'll support us there👊
— Morten Vollan (@zEVEScsgo) March 11, 2018
